A | B |
auxilliary | helper, aid, giving assistance or support |
candid | frank, sincere, impartial, unposed |
cubicle | a small room or compartment |
drudgery | work that is hard and tiresome |
envoy | a representative or messenger(as of a government) |
escalate | to elevate, to increase in intesity |
expedient | a means to an end, advantageous, useful |
feign | to pretend |
flair | a natural quality, talent or skill; a distinctive style |
grievous | causing sorrow or pain;serious |
heterogeneous | composed of different kinds; diverse |
horde | a vast number(as of people); a throng |
impel | to force,drive forward |
incredulous | disbelieving, skeptical |
inscribe | to write or engrave; to enter a name on a list |
monologue | a speech by one actor; a long talk by one person |
prognosis | a forecast of the probable course and outcome of a disease or situation |
rasping | with a harsh, grating sound; a harsh sound |
repugnant | offensive, disagreeable, distasteful |
scuttle | to sink a ship buy cutting holes in it; to get rid of something in a decisive way; to run hastily, scurry; pail |
